
Undiknas Faculty of Pharmacy and Health Sciences Launches First Social Service Program: Bringing Hope and Harmony to SOS Children’s Village Bali
Denpasar – The Faculty of Pharmacy and Health Sciences at Universitas Pendidikan Nasional (Undiknas) has successfully conducted its inaugural social service activity titled Integrated Health and Social Care (IHSC) 2025. Carrying the theme “The Heart of Care, Hope, and Harmony in Collaboration,” the event was filled with warmth and a spirit of giving at SOS Children’s Village Bali, starting from 7:00 AM WITA until completion.
IHSC 2025 marks a meaningful first step for the Faculty of Pharmacy and Health Sciences in delivering tangible community service. Through a variety of interactive and educational activities, the event created a collaborative space between students, lecturers, and the community to generate a positive social impact.
The event not only served as a moment of sharing but also reinforced core values of empathy, solidarity, and compassion—fundamental principles in the field of health. The active participation of all attendees and the support of various stakeholders were key to the success of this initiative.
IHSC 2025 is expected to be the foundation for the Faculty of Pharmacy and Health Sciences’ ongoing commitment to impactful and sustainable social activities—both in the health sector and in fostering harmony with all elements of society.
